Unfortunately the stack trace doesn't tell us much beyond its
something related to pthreads, it could be a bug in pthreads itself, a
bug in OpenThreads, or a bug in OSG but we so far have absolutely no
way of telling.  You'll need to try and isolate the failure condition
from the top level - by starting off with basic examples that do very
little to see if they crash then build up to examples that are known
to crash.  The most stripped down example will be osgversion, then
osgconv, then moving up to osgviewer.  Could you try these are report
back what happens.

BTW, your the first person to report this problem, so either there is
something particular about your system or the way you are using it, or
no one else has yet compiled 2.x under FreeBSD.   Perhaps if others
are working under FreeBSD then can come forward with there experiences
to see if there is any pattern to this problem.

> abort() was called in pthreads before main() was ever reached.
> Happens on two different OSG programs (run fine on Linux/Mac/M$).
> OSG 1.2 runs fine on the same FreeBSD system.
>
> [New LWP 100101]
> [New Thread 0x80ae000 (LWP 100134)]
> Fatal error 'Recurse on a private mutex.' at line 986 in file
> /usr/src/lib/libpthread/thread/thr_mutex.c (errno = 0)
> [New Thread 0x80ae200 (LWP 100132)]
>
> Program received signal SIGABRT, Aborted.
> [Switching to Thread 0x80ae200 (LWP 100132)]
> 0x289085b7 in pthread_testcancel () from /lib/libpthread.so.2
> (gdb) bt
> #0  0x289085b7 in pthread_testcancel () from /lib/libpthread.so.2
> #1  0x288f5c01 in sigaction () from /lib/libpthread.so.2
> #2  0x288f5eed in sigaction () from /lib/libpthread.so.2
> #3  0x288f66cc in sigaction () from /lib/libpthread.so.2
> #4  0x288f6878 in sigaction () from /lib/libpthread.so.2
> #5  0x28900ec8 in pthread_mutexattr_init () from /lib/libpthread.so.2
> #6  0x294b0470 in ?? ()
